Omnichannel Order Management: A Catalyst for Retail Success

Omnichannel Order Management

Consumers today don’t follow a linear path when making purchasing decisions. They might first hear about a product on social media, check reviews on a website, purchase through a mobile app, and finally pick it up in-store. This “shopping journey” is fragmented across multiple sales channels, and customers expect a seamless experience no matter where they interact with a brand. Here’s where omnichannel order management becomes an indispensable asset for retailers.

Omnichannel order management refers to the process of managing customer orders across all sales channels, such as online stores, physical locations, marketplaces, and social media, in a unified system. This ensures a unified view of inventory levels and customer data and provides a seamless shopping experience regardless of where customers place their orders. 

The need for adopting an omnichannel order management software is backed by research:

  • 80% of consumers use multiple channels to complete purchases, and 73% engage with more than one channel during their buying journey.
  • Omnichannel customers spend 30% more and have a 30% higher lifetime value than single-channel shoppers. They are also 1.7 times more likely to make repeat purchases and 46% more likely to recommend brands.
  • Businesses with strong omnichannel strategies retain 89% of their customers, compared to just 33% for those without, and 87% of brands with strong omnichannel strategies report outperforming their competitors.

Forward-thinking retailers are already leveraging omnichannel order management to drive efficiency and growth. Take Debenhams, for example—a 243-year-old department store reimagined as a direct-to-consumer brand by Boohoo Group in 2021. With fabric’s omnichannel capabilities, Debenhams expanded its product catalog to 3 million SKUs across 11 brands and went live in just three weeks. This transformation enabled the retailer to manage thousands of collections seamlessly, improving online shopping experiences and streamlining operations.

Adopting omnichannel order management strategies clearly helps increase customer loyalty, repeat sales, and long-term competitive advantage. For retailers looking to remain competitive, omnichannel order management is no longer optional—it’s a necessity. Read on as we explore the benefits and strategies of effective omnichannel order management for your retail business.

The challenges of traditional order management

Traditional order management systems (OMS) were designed for single-channel retail, where inventory and orders were managed separately for each sales channel. However, in today’s retail landscape, customers expect seamless integration between online stores, offline channels, and marketplaces. Siloed OMS falls short of customer expectations with inaccurate inventory tracking and slow fulfillment processes. Let’s look at all these challenges in brief.

Lack of real-time inventory visibility

Many legacy systems rely on batch processing, where inventory updates occur at scheduled intervals rather than instantly. This delay means that an item might be listed as “available” online, but it has already been purchased in-store.

Inaccurate stock levels

A retailer using disconnected systems may have excess inventory in one warehouse while another location faces stockouts. Without a centralized system consolidating stock information across all sales channels, businesses risk overstocking in some areas while losing sales in others.

Increased risk of stockouts and overselling

If a retailer sells on multiple marketplaces like Amazon and Walmart but updates inventory manually, a surge in demand could result in more orders than available stock. This leads to canceled orders, refund processing delays, and potential penalties from marketplace partners.

Incomplete info for customers and customer service representatives

Customers today expect transparency—they want to know if an item is in stock, when it will arrive, and where to pick it up. However, with traditional systems, this information isn’t always accurate or easily accessible. If a customer contacts support to check product availability or modify an order, agents may struggle to retrieve real-time data, leading to longer resolution times and a poor customer experience.

Manual order processing

Many retailers still rely on manual order processing, where employees must input, verify, and route orders by hand. This slows down fulfillment times and increases the risk of human error. A miskeyed address, incorrect SKU entry, or misrouted order can result in delayed shipments or costly returns.

Slow order fulfillment times

A fashion retailer experiencing a sudden surge in demand during a holiday sale may struggle to fulfill orders quickly if its system cannot automatically allocate inventory to the nearest fulfillment center. At such times, customers are more likely to abandon future purchases when orders take longer than expected.

Increased shipping costs

Without an omnichannel system that optimizes fulfillment locations, an order might be shipped from a warehouse across the country rather than a store just a few miles away.

Limited order fulfillment options

Customers want to choose between home delivery, in-store pickup, curbside pickup, and same-day delivery. However, legacy systems often lack the integration needed to support these options efficiently. For instance, if a customer selects in-store pickup but the retailer’s system doesn’t sync with store inventory in real-time, they may arrive to find their order unavailable.

Limited customer visibility into orders or ability to change orders

Customers may receive a tracking number but lack real-time updates or the ability to modify their order after checkout. This lack of transparency leads to increased support inquiries, as customers contact service teams for status updates, cancellations, or modifications—placing additional strain on customer service operations.

The benefits of omnichannel order management

Implementing an omnichannel OMS is a game-changer for modern retailers. It enables seamless integration between digital and physical storefronts, and here’s how it drives business value.

Improved customer experience

A robust omnichannel OMS accelerates order fulfillment by dynamically allocating inventory across warehouses, stores, and third-party logistics providers. This ensures faster deliveries and minimizes out-of-stock scenarios. Automated order processing enhances accuracy, reducing fulfillment errors that lead to costly returns. Additionally, flexible fulfillment options—such as buy online, pick up in-store (BOPIS), ship-from-store, and same-day delivery—allow retailers to meet customer expectations with unparalleled convenience. Real-time order tracking and automated notifications boost customer trust and satisfaction, fostering long-term loyalty.

Increased operational efficiency

By centralizing inventory and order data across all sales channels, an omnichannel OMS reduces processing costs and eliminates inefficiencies caused by siloed systems. Real-time inventory visibility prevents stock imbalances, ensuring accurate demand forecasting and smarter replenishment. Advanced order routing logic selects the most optimal fulfillment location, balancing speed and cost-effectiveness. Additionally, automation streamlines customer service operations by providing instant access to order history, shipment status, and return eligibility—allowing support teams to resolve issues faster with fewer resources.

Enhanced revenue growth

A seamless omnichannel experience directly impacts conversion rates. Customers with access to accurate stock availability and convenient fulfillment options are less likely to abandon their carts. Optimized fulfillment strategies also reduce last-mile delivery costs, making operations more profitable. By consistently delivering fast, reliable, and flexible shopping experiences, retailers increase customer satisfaction and drive higher lifetime value and repeat purchases.

Retailers who rely on fabric OMS for omnichannel fulfillment experience tangible results, including a 30% increase in conversion rates, a 30% reduction in total cost of ownership (TCO), and a 3% decrease in split shipments—all backed by a 99.99% uptime for uninterrupted operations.

Building a robust omnichannel order management system

To fully capitalize on the benefits of an omnichannel strategy, retailers must implement a scalable and intelligent OMS. This requires seamless inventory, fulfillment, and customer experience coordination through cutting-edge technology and data-driven processes.

Centralized inventory management

A robust omnichannel OMS functions as a unified, enterprise-wide inventory hub, aggregating inventory data across warehouses, brick-and-mortar locations, third-party suppliers, and fulfillment centers. By maintaining a single source of truth, retailers can effectively manage inventory, prevent discrepancies, eliminate overselling, and enable real-time demand forecasting. Advanced AI-driven stock replenishment mechanisms adjust inventory levels dynamically, reducing holding costs while ensuring product availability in high-demand regions.

Order routing and fulfillment optimization

Intelligent order orchestration is at the core of a high-performing OMS. The system dynamically evaluates order fulfillment pathways based on predefined business rules, factoring in real-time inventory availability, shipping costs, warehouse proximity, and last-mile logistics efficiency. By implementing distributed order management (DOM), retailers can optimize fulfillment flows through ship-from-store, designated online fulfillment centers (or “dark stores”), micro-fulfillment centers, or traditional warehouses, ensuring cost-effective, expedited delivery. Machine learning algorithms continuously refine routing logic, improving fulfillment efficiency over time and reducing split shipments, directly lowering logistics expenses.

Customer-centric order management

A modern omnichannel OMS must deliver a frictionless, hyper-personalized customer experience. By offering flexible fulfillment options—such as BOPIS, curbside pickup, same-day delivery, and expedited shipping—retailers can empower consumers to choose the most convenient fulfillment method. Additionally, proactive order tracking powered by real-time logistics data ensures customers receive timely, accurate purchase updates. AI-driven customer support automation enables instant order modifications, seamless returns management, and personalized post-purchase engagement, further strengthening brand loyalty.

Leverage fabric for a superior omnichannel strategy

As consumer expectations for seamless, integrated shopping experiences continue to rise, retailers must adopt modern solutions to stay ahead. Implementing a robust omnichannel OMS enhances operational efficiency, strengthens customer relationships, and drives long-term revenue growth.

fabric OMS is designed to help businesses achieve omnichannel excellence. With a centralized inventory management platform, retailers gain real-time visibility and control over stock across all sales channels, eliminating overselling and stockouts. Intelligent order routing ensures the most efficient and cost-effective fulfillment, optimizing delivery speed and reducing logistics expenses. Additionally, fabric’s AI-powered system enhances the customer experience with seamless order tracking, flexible fulfillment options, and automated customer support. This means the system uses artificial intelligence, like machine learning, to automate tasks, personalize experiences, and make decisions to improve efficiency and customer satisfaction.

fabric reimagines order management with cutting-edge AI-driven capabilities, empowering retailers to meet the demands of modern consumers while maintaining operational agility. Don’t let outdated systems hold your business back—schedule a demo today to learn how fabric can unlock the full potential of omnichannel order management for your brand.


Editorial Team

Digital content editorial team @ fabric.

Ready to see fabric OMS in action?